Accident occurred Sunday, August 07, 1983 in TULSA, OK
Aircraft: CESSNA 152, registration: N67452
Injuries: 1 Uninjured.
NTSB investigators may not have traveled in support of this investigation and used data provided by various sources to prepare this aircraft accident report.THE ACFT COLLIDED WITH A FENCE AND A POWERLINE DURING TAKEOFF CLIMB. THE STUDENT PILOT WAS VISITING A SMALL FIELD WITH A1300 FT RWY OF SOD FOR PRACTICE. THE C-152 USES 1340 FT TO CLEAR A 50 FT OBSTABCLE FOR A STANDARD DAY ON A SURFACED RWY THIS DAY WAS ABOVE STANDARD REQUIRING MORE TAKEOFF DISTANCE AND DECREASING CLIMB PERFORMANCE.
